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us provide phase, frequency and gain characterization and mitigation in a synchronized code division multiple access (SCDMA) burst receiver via use of dedicated phase and frequency correction loops that implemented to deal with the unique characteristics of a SCDMA signal. The way coded and un-coded bits are interleaved within a given frame requires that all symbols related to that frame be captured in a dedicated storage medium such as a RAM prior to the beginning of the data processing. The method and apparatus substantially eliminate gain, phase, and frequency, among other impairments caused by the transmitter, channel and analog parts of the SCDMA burst receiver.
